Richard Kellys Southland Tales, a science-fiction comedy about the aftermath of the Third World War, is set in Los Angeles circa 2008, roughly three years after a sudden nuclear attack on Texas. In June 2008, Boxer Santaros (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son), an action movie star with ties to the Republican Party, disappears. A closed system that defies the Law would be along the lines of, for example, an electric car which completely recharges itself via the process of driving it around, requiring no external power once it's been turned on. In the "Southland Tales" universe, when war broke out following the nuclear attacks in Texas, Treer was contracted to build several mega-zeppelins to ferry troops and equipment across the world. Southland Tales grossed $275,380 in limited release at the North American box office and $99,363 in Turkey and United Kingdom for a worldwide total of $374,743,[6] against a production budget of $17 million. As a tie-in, Kelly has also produced three graphic novels ("Two Roads Diverge," "Fingerprints" and "The Mechanicals" -- now available as "Southland Tales: The Prequel Saga") that explain the film's back story. Dr. Severin Exx read Krysta the Book of Revelation while she was under hypnosis. The movie and prequel saga focus a lot on the "blood red" version of the drug which gives the person using the drug ability to see, or "bleed", into the past, and with repeated use, the future.
